Tripadvisor performs checks on reviews. - OfftheRoadontheTrackMunich, Germany104 contributionsDuring our short Madrid visit, we were looking for a place to have a coffee and have some rest. The cafe fulfilled our needs in that sense. Some details:
Atmosphere: Quite nice, cosy
Menu: Simple foods (sandwich, tortilla, etc.) and drinks
Prices: Prices were average. We paid for a tortilla 2,5€ and for cappuccino something around 2€
Staff: They were kind but cannot speak English
All in all, nice cafe. If you are around, you can stop by.Written 9 July 2015This review is the subjective opinion of a Tripadvisor member and not of Tripadvisor LLC.
